About us

Our family have served the South East Texas since 1965. We have 4 techs and we strive to keep all training and certifications up to date and have the latest equipment and information to fix todays vehicles.

Wayne’s does good work. We’ve taken three cars to them, a Nissan Sentra, a Ford
Contour, and my baby, a ’67 Chevy Impala. They did a thorough job each time,
and none of the issues have resurfaced. I don’t trust just anyone with my baby,
but I do trust Wayne’s. Their prices have been very fair every time. It’s hard
to find a good mechanic, but I finally found one, and I’m sticking with them.
